2- Find a Product to Promote

You’d think.. this would be simple as well. Unfortunately not every single product and company has an affiliate program. And a lot that do, you have to sign up form on other platforms to become an affiliate. Now, this isn’t necessarily difficult, but it can be time consuming to set up accounts with various different platforms and companies. Additionally, not all affiliate offers are created equal. Being an Amazon Associate (this is the name of their affiliate program) is awesome because let’s face it, what can’t you buy on Amazon these days? but their commission rates are typically fairly low (less than 5%) and there are a lot of low ticket items on Amazon. On the other hand, high ticket offers can be very lucrative but harder to find. Digital products for example, tend to have higher commissions on a higher purchase price, so this can potentially bring in more revenue, but how many people are looking for a particular software in your chosen niche?

5- Make Commission Sales

Did you know that most people don’t buy the first time they’re presented with an offer? Would you be surprised to learn it takes multiple visits usually over a period of time before people are actually ready to commit? Even on small ticket sales? Have you heard of a sales funnel? Do you know what an autoresponder is? Actually getting a sale through your affiliate link on the internet is the ultimate goal of every affiliate marketer and thankfully there are amazing tools out there to help you do that! A sales funnel is used to drive traffic from an ad, to some sort of sign-in or opt-in page, or to the offer itself. Email marketing is also a huge part of affiliate and digital marketing in general, and having an autoresponder handle that email volume for you is crucial because it can help re-direct people back to your offer since, as I said, most won’t buy the first time they see it.
